A hinge joint, such as the elbow or knee, typically has one degree of freedom. This means that it can move in one plane or axis, allowing for flexion and extension movements. The restriction to movement in this joint is due to its anatomical structure, which includes a single axis of rotation.
A hinge joint. Using your knee as an example of what this means: Standing up you can bend the knee so that your leg is bent behind you, but you cannt twist it or move it in any other way. This is what it is meant by only one plane of movement. Other joints such as your shoulder allow you to move your arm in many different ways meaning it has several planes of movement.

Three bones meet at the elbow joint: the humerus (upper arm bone), the radius, and the ulna (forearm bones). These bones come together to form a hinge joint that allows for flexion and extension of the arm.
The ankle has one degree of freedom, allowing it to move up and down like a hinge joint. The foot has multiple degrees of freedom, with joints like the subtalar joint providing more complex movements like inversion and eversion.

A universal joint has two degrees of freedom. It allows for rotational movement around two axes, enabling the connected shafts to pivot in different directions. This flexibility helps accommodate misalignments between the shafts while transmitting torque.
The condyloid joint, also known as an ellipsoidal joint, has two degrees of freedom. This allows for movement in two planes: flexion and extension, as well as abduction and adduction. A common example of a condyloid joint is the wrist joint, which enables various movements while still providing stability.
